Sorts Of Scaffolding
Although scaffolding systems can vary extensively in layout and application, they typically fall under numerous distinctive categories that cater to different building and construction demands - Scaffolding. One of the most common types include supported scaffolding, put on hold scaffolding, and rolling scaffolding
Supported scaffolding includes systems supported by a framework of poles, which give a secure and raised working surface area. This type is generally made use of for jobs that need significant altitude, such as bricklaying or outside paint.
Suspended scaffolding, on the other hand, is used for projects calling for accessibility to high elevations, such as cleansing or repairing structure facades. This system hangs from one more structure or a roof, allowing employees to lower or elevate the platform as needed.
Rolling scaffolding functions wheels that enable easy movement across a job website. It is specifically valuable for tasks that call for frequent moving, such as indoor job in big rooms.
Each sort of scaffolding is developed with particular applications in mind, making sure that construction jobs can be accomplished successfully and properly. Recognizing these classifications is vital for picking the appropriate scaffolding system to fulfill both job needs and site conditions.
Secret Safety And Security Attributes
Security is vital in scaffolding systems, as the potential risks connected with operating at elevations can lead to significant crashes otherwise properly handled. Secret security features are necessary to ensure the health of employees and the honesty of the building and construction site.
Primarily, guardrails are crucial. These barriers provide a physical secure versus drops, dramatically decreasing the threat of severe injuries. In addition, toe boards are commonly used to stop devices and products from diminishing the scaffold, protecting workers below.
Another important component is the use of non-slip surfaces on systems. This feature enhances hold, specifically in unfavorable climate condition, thereby lessening the likelihood of slides and falls. Additionally, gain access to ladders should be firmly placed to facilitate safe access and leave from the scaffold.
Routine examinations and upkeep of scaffolding systems are likewise important. These inspections make sure that all parts remain in great condition and functioning properly, dealing with any wear or damage quickly.
Lastly, proper training for all employees associated with scaffolding procedures is vital to ensure that they understand safety and security protocols and can determine potential threats. Upkeep and Inspections
The efficiency of scaffolding systems prolongs beyond first design and implementation; ongoing upkeep and regular examinations are important to guaranteeing their proceeded performance and safety throughout the duration of a project. Regular evaluations need to be carried out by qualified personnel to identify any type of indicators of wear, damages, or instability that can jeopardize the stability of the scaffolding.
Maintenance methods must include routine checks of structural parts, such as fittings, frames, and slabs, making sure that all elements continue to be protected and totally free from deterioration or various other damage. Additionally, the capability of security features, such as guardrails and toe boards, should be assessed to guarantee conformity with safety policies.
